Galileo Signs New Full Content Agreement with British Airways

Search ASIA Travel Tips .com Monday, 26 March 2007

Galileo has signed a new long-term, global full content agreement with British Airways. The new three-year contract which will begin on 10 April 2007 will see British Airways fares and inventory made available to all Galileo-connected travel agents. British Airways has also agreed, under this new deal, not to impose a GDS surcharge on bookings made by Galileo-connected travel agents.

Tiffany Hall, British Airways Head of Marketing and Distribution, said, “We have been working with the GDSs for some time as our previous contracts expired at the end of February. We are very pleased to have reached an agreement with Galileo, which will reduce the airline's distribution costs and ensures that our lowest fares can continue to be distributed to all Galileo travel agents.”

As well as providing agents with enriched GDS content, Galileo has recognised the need to develop integrated solutions focused on allowing agents to offer the most comprehensive travel content to their customers. Through Galileo Leisure, Galileo Flight Integrator (Asia) and Galileo Low Cost Air (Australia), Galileo has delivered a new way to serve the needs of full service carriers, low cost carriers and the agents by bringing airline (non-GDS, Hosted & GDS-Hosted) content to the agency desktop in an integrated way.
